After 58 years, it’s time to think and act anew


FOR millions of citizens born before 1957, Merdeka celebrations revive warm memories of that glorious moment 58 years ago when Malaya met its tryst with destiny. Across the land, eyes are welling up as the national anthem is sung and young and old are uniting behind our Jalur Gemilang. A wave of patriotism is sweeping the country. It is befitting therefore to reflect on the meaning and significance of this timely and timeless ideal.

As with most concepts, patriotism is so multi-dimensional that it cannot be reduced to a simple formula. One cannot define it but only describe it.
